Which area does Bloomfield NJ belong to?

Welcome to Bloomfield, a charming township located in Essex county, Northern New Jersey. As a northwestern suburb of Newark, Bloomfield offers a convenient location for those looking to visit both the city and the suburbs. This area was settled in 1660 by Puritans and was originally known as Wardsesson, a ward of Newark. However, in 1796 it was given its current name in honor of American Revolutionary general Joseph Bloomfield. Come explore Bloomfield and experience some of its rich history and vibrant culture.

What is the size of Bloomfield, NJ?

If you are planning to visit Bloomfield, New Jersey, it may interest you to know that the township covers about 5.36 square miles (13.88 km2), with 5.34 square miles (13.82 km2) of land and 0.02 square miles (0.06 km2) of water (0.45%). How many homes are in Bloomfield?

When you visit Bloomfield, New Jersey, you'll find a charming town with approximately 20,785 housing units. Many of these properties were built around 1948, giving the area a beautiful historic feel. Of the 19,959 occupied housing units, you'll find that just over half are owner-occupied, while the rest are homes to renters. What happened in Bloomfield New York in the past?

Welcome to East Bloomfield, a charming town with a rich history dating back to 1789. Originally called Bloomfield, it was split into East Bloomfield and West Bloomfield in 1833. In 1990, the adjacent villages of East Bloomfield and Holcomb were combined to create the village of Bloomfield. Is Bloomfield NJ a town or a city?

Welcome to Bloomfield, New Jersey! This charming area is actually a township located in Essex County. As of the 2020 United States census, the population was 53,105, which is an increase of 12.2% from the previous count in 2010.
